  • Spikeline alloys Weight

    Does anyone know their weight?
    without the tyres, interested. Maybe someone have them without tyres fitted, or done that already?

    One guy is using his roady as a track car, and trying to get all the bits as light as possible (already stripped the interior)


    Thanks in advance

  • #2
    Re: Spikeline alloys Weight

    they'll be 15-16kg

    the lightest wheels are steels and spinlines (both 15 inch) at 12-14kg depending on front or back.
